In current scenarios, a variety of network applications are being developed for meeting the growing business needs for Industries. These applications are complex in nature, use new protocols and port numbers from the range of the dynamic ports. For Quality of Service (QoS) assessment of these applications, traffic classification is the first and most important step. Each network application has distinct characteristics and its generated traffic also implicitly follows these characteristics. The main focus is on collecting the set of those traffic statistical features which are most suitable to correctly represent the applications under consideration for the classification task. In this paper, focus is on traffic classification in the Software Defined Networks (SDN). This paper has a proposed traffic classification and QoS assessment architecture. This proposed architecture is used for classifying the incoming traffic at the network edge devices. For classification purpose, six different machine learning algorithms have been used. Various type of traffic have been generated by using Distributed-Internet Traffic Generator. Further, the performance of these classifiers have been evaluated using the confusion matrix. A comparative performance study is done in the last. This work is based on the traffic statistical feature analysis and collected statistical features are evaluated for finding their relative importance in the task of classification. The proposed architecture works in the existing SDN environment and requires low computation, as only the important features have been passed and analyzed for the traffic classification.
